Ingredients Overview
Essential Ingredients for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p)
Here’s a comprehensive list of the ingredients you’ll need to make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os. Each ingredient plays a crucial role in achieving the dish’s amazing flavors while offering various health benefits.
- For the Shrimp:
- 1 pound jumbo shrimp (peeled and deveined) – Rich in protein and low in calories.
- ½ cup cornstarch (or gluten-free flour as a substitute) – Provides a crispy coating.
- 1 large egg – Helps the coating adhere to the shrimp.
-
Oil for frying (or use an air fryer for a healthier option) – Helps achieve a crispy texture.
-
For the Bang Bang Sauce:
- ½ cup mayonnaise – Adds creaminess.
- 2 tablespoons sweet chili sauce – Provides sweetness and a touch of spice.
- 1 tablespoon Sriracha (adjust to taste) – For heat and flavor.
-
1 teaspoon lime juice – Enhances freshness.
-
For the Tacos:
- 8 small corn or flour tortillas – Base for the tacos (choose corn for gluten-free).
- 1 cup shredded cabbage – Adds crunch and color.
- 1 avocado (sliced) – Provides healthy fats.
- Fresh cilantro (for garnish) – Offers a burst of flavor and freshness.

How to Prepare the Perfect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p): Step-by-Step Guide
Creating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p) is an enjoyable process.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you achieve the perfect balance of flavors and textures:
-
Prepare the Shrimp:
Begin by thoroughly rinsing the shrimp under cold water. Pat them dry with a paper towel to ensure the coating adheres well. -
Create the Coating:
In a medium bowl, whisk together the cornstarch and the egg until smooth. Coat each shrimp in the mixture, allowing any excess to drip off. This will create a crispy layer when fried or baked. -
Heat the Oil:
If frying, pour about 1 inch of oil into a heavy-bottomed pan and heat over medium-high heat. If using an air fryer, preheat it to 400°F (200°C). -
Cook the Shrimp:
- Frying Method: Carefully place shrimp into the hot oil. Fry them for about 2-3 minutes on each side or until golden and crispy. Remove and drain on paper towels.
-
Air Fryer Method: Place the coated shrimp in a single layer in the basket. Cook for about 8-10 minutes, shaking halfway through for even cooking.
-
Prepare the Bang Bang Sauce:
In a small bowl, combine mayonnaise, sweet chili sauce, Sriracha, and lime juice. Adjust the heat with Sriracha according to your preference. Mix well until smooth. -
Assemble the Tacos:
Warm the tortillas in a dry skillet for about 30 seconds on each side. Lay down a base of shredded cabbage, then add the crispy shrimp on top. Drizzle with the Bang Bang sauce and add slices of avocado. -
Garnish and Serve:
Top with fresh cilantro and, if desired, an extra squeeze of lime for freshness. Serve immediately and watch your guests enjoy!
With these clear and precise steps, anyone, regardless of their cooking experience, can master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os.
Mastering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p): Advanced Tips and Variations
To elevate your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os further, consider these advanced tips and variations:
-
Marination:
For added depth of flavor, marinate the shrimp in lime juice, garlic, and a pinch of cumin for about 30 minutes before coating and cooking. This step enhances the shrimp’s taste. -
Experiment with Spices:
Add a variety of spices to the cornstarch for the coating. Paprika, garlic powder, or even black pepper can provide a more robust flavor profile. -
Change the Sauce:
Instead of the traditional Bang Bang sauce, try a mango salsa or a cucumber yogurt sauce for a refreshing twist. This variation can perfectly complement the tacos while cutting down on calories. -
Try Different Fillings:
Other fillings work great in the tacos, such as grilled corn, black beans, or pico de gallo. Characterizing the tacos with layered textures can make a simple meal extraordinary. -
Garnish Creatively:
Instead of just cilantro, enhance your dish with jalapeño slices, crumbled feta, or diced radishes for an added crunch and unique flavor.

How to Store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p): Best Practices
To maintain the freshness of your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os, follow these storage tips:
-
Refrigerating:
If you have leftover tacos, allow them to cool completely. Store the shrimp and the sauce separately from the tortillas and garnishes in airtight containers in the fridge. Consume within 2-3 days for the best texture and flavor. -
Freezing:
For longer storage, freeze the cooked shrimp in an airtight freezer bag. The shrimp can maintain quality for up to 2 months. Avoid freezing the sauce and tortillas together, as they may become soggy upon thawing. -
Reheating:
When you’re ready to eat, reheat the shrimp in an oven or air fryer to regain its crispiness. Avoid using a microwave, which can make shrimp rubbery. Heat the tortillas separately in a skillet until warm and pliable.

FAQs: Frequently Asked Questions About Bang Bang Shrimp Tacos (Dynamite Shrimp)
Q: Can I use frozen shrimp for this recipe?
Yes, absolutely! Just ensure the shrimp are thawed and patted dry before coating and cooking.
Q: Can I make Bang Bang sauce ahead of time?
Certainly! The sauce can be made a day in advance, stored in the refrigerator in an airtight container, and used when you’re ready to assemble the tacos.
Q: How can I make this recipe healthier?
You can reduce calories by using less mayonnaise in the Bang Bang sauce or replacing it with Greek yogurt. Additionally, consider baking rather than frying the shrimp.
Q: Are there any vegetarian options for this recipe?
Yes! You can use plant-based shrimp, tofu, or even cauliflower florets to replicate the texture and taste.
Q: What types of tortillas are best?
Corn tortillas are a great gluten-free option and add an authentic Mexican flavor. However, you can use whole wheat or flour tortillas based on your preference.
Q: Can I add more spices to the shrimp?
Absolutely! Feel free to adjust the seasonings according to your taste; adding chili powder or cajun seasoning can also bring an exciting twist.
